Our growing client is currently seeking a Learning and Development Manager to join their team on a permanent basis. The successful Learning and Development Manager will shape the development of people, and lead the day-to-day delivery of learning activities across skills.
The Learning and Development Manager will use a range of L&D methodologies:
- Deliver annual learning objectives
- Design and deliver blended learning that drives measurable performance improvement
- Translate business needs into practical, relevant development programmes
- Create high-quality learning content
- Use data and insight to shape decisions and improve outcomes
Key Skills and Experience:
- Proven experience in an L&D Manager or similar role
- Strong hands-on experience designing and delivering blended learning
- Proven ability to translate business objectives into practical development programmes
- Excellent coaching skills
- Strong communication and stakeholder management skills
